Physical Bauxite Processing: Crushing and Grinding of Bauxite
2022123 In this case the grinding circuit comprises an open circuit rod mill followed by a closed-circuit ball mill. The ball mill is most often closed over a classifier like a hydro cyclone (Fig. 3.11) or DSM style screen with a fine cut of 1–1.5 mm. Grinding in Ball Mills: Modeling and Process Control
There are three types of grinding media that are commonly used in ball mills: • steel and other metal balls; • metal cylindrical bodies called cylpebs; • ceramic balls with regular or high density. Steel and other metal balls are the most frequently used grinding media with sizes of the balls ranging from 10 to 150 mm in diameter [30].

Chapter 1 Soils Tex-116-E, Ball Mill Method for
200691 The result of this test is known as the Wet Ball Mill (WBM) value. Apparatus The following apparatus is required: ♦ wet ball mill machine, consisting of a watertight steel cylinder, closed at one end, with inside dimensions of 258.8 ± 3 mm (10.188 ± 1/8 in.) in diameter and 273.1 ± 3 mm (10.75 ± 1/8 in.) in length.
